What affects the price

Building an ADU involves several moving parts that shape your total investment. The final figure depends heavily on whether you choose a prefab unit or a custom build from the ground up. Site conditions are another major factor; if your property requires extensive grading, utility trenching, or foundation work, costs will climb. You also have to consider your choice of finishes, like high-end appliances or custom cabinetry. Navigating local permit fees and impact assessments also adds to the total.

About this service

A contractor oversees the physical build, managing the subcontractors, materials, and daily construction progress. They are responsible for making sure the structure is built according to the approved plans and local safety standards. You need a contractor when you have your designs finalized and are ready for the actual building phase to begin. They act as the primary point of contact for all site activity.
